The Cairns (CNS) → Brisbane (BNE) air route links Far North Queensland with the state capital over 865 miles (1,392 km). It’s a high-demand domestic corridor for travelers moving between the Great Barrier Reef region and Brisbane’s business, events, and onward international connections. Nonstop flights typically take about 2 hours 15 minutes to 2 hours 35 minutes, depending on winds and aircraft type. Travelers choose this route to swap tropical reef-and-rainforest adventures for Brisbane’s urban culture, dining, and easy access to the Gold Coast and Sunshine Coast. It’s also popular for visiting friends and family, university travel, and cruise or conference itineraries, with frequent schedules that make same-day trips and short weekend breaks practical.
Book early for school-holiday periods and major weekends; typical one-way fares can range from AUD 120–300 (about USD 80–200), with sales occasionally lower. Cairns Airport is compact—arrive 60–90 minutes before departure, and keep an eye on gate changes during peak times. At Brisbane Airport, follow clear signage for Airtrain to the CBD or rideshare zones; allow extra time if you’re connecting to an international flight. Expect a standard domestic service: minimal turbulence is common over the coast, and cabin temperatures can feel cool, so pack a light layer. Choose a window seat on the right side for coastal views on approach to Brisbane when conditions are clear.
Brisbane pairs riverside scenery with a laid-back, subtropical city vibe. Start at South Bank Parklands for the river promenade, galleries, and the Streets Beach lagoon, then ride the CityCat ferry for skyline views. The Queensland Art Gallery and Gallery of Modern Art (QAGOMA) is a standout for contemporary and Australian collections. For nature close to town, visit Lone Pine Koala Sanctuary or hike Mount Coot-tha for panoramic lookouts and the botanic gardens. Food highlights include modern Australian dining, fresh seafood, and local specialties like Moreton Bay bugs; Fortitude Valley and West End are popular for bars, live music, and multicultural eats. New Farm and Teneriffe offer relaxed cafes and riverwalks.
Brisbane is warm year-round, with drier, mild weather from May to October often preferred for sightseeing. November to March is hotter and more humid, with summer storms; fares can rise around Christmas and New Year. Peak pricing commonly aligns with Queensland school holidays, so booking 6–10 weeks ahead helps. Shoulder months like May, June, August, and September often balance pleasant weather with better availability. Notable drawcards include the Brisbane Festival (September) and summer cricket, which can tighten inventory and lift fares.
